| 摘要: |
| 本文研究了包含频散项的K(2,3)方程ut+(u2)x-(u3)xxx=0的分支问题.利用动力系统的定性分析,并且借助Maple软件进行数值模拟得到行波解系统相应的相图,然后通过积分计算得到周期尖波解、类扭波和类反扭波的精确解的函数表达式,以及孤立波精确解的隐函数表达式. |
| 关键词: 周期尖波解 类扭波解 类反扭波解 孤立波 相图分支 |

| EXACT TRAVELING WAVE SOLUTIONS OF THE OSMOSIS K(2, 3) EQUATION |

| Abstract: |
| In this paper, we study the bifurcation of K(2, 3) equation ut+(u2)x-(u3)xxx=0 with osmosis dispersion. Using the qualitative analysis methods of dynamical system and numerical simulation by Maple programs, illustrative phase portraits corresponding to traveling wave system are presented, and expressions of a periodic cusp wave, kink-like and antikink-like wave solutions, and implicit expression of soliton are explicitly given after integrals. |
| Key words: periodic cusp wave solution kink-like wave solution antikink-like wave solution soliton the bifurcation of phase portraits |
